Input Sources
Sources produce core.LogEntry values for a pipeline. Every source is declared
as a [[pipelines.plugin_sources]] entry with an id, a type, and a
type-specific config table.
[[pipelines.plugin_sources]]
id = "app_logs"
type = "file"
[pipelines.plugin_sources.config]
directory = "/var/log/myapp"
Registered types: file, console, random, null, tcp_chain,
http_chain.
Publication from any source is non-blocking. When a subscriber channel is full
the entry is dropped and counted in dropped_entries.
file
Tails every file in a directory whose name matches a glob.
[[pipelines.plugin_sources]]
id = "app_logs"
type = "file"
[pipelines.plugin_sources.config]
directory = "/var/log/myapp"
pattern = "*.log"
check_interval_ms = 100
raw = false
from = "end"
| Option | Type | Default | Description |
|---|---|---|---|
directory |
string | required | Directory to scan; not recursive |
pattern |
string | * |
Glob over filenames; * and ? only |
check_interval_ms |
int | 100 |
Directory rescan interval; minimum 10 |
raw |
bool | false |
Never parse a line: the whole line is the message |
from |
string | end |
Where a new watcher starts: end or start of the file |
Behaviour
check_interval_msgoverns how often the directory is rescanned for new or removed files. Tailing an already-open file polls on a fixed 100 ms interval that this option does not change.- Each matched file gets its own watcher. Watchers for files that disappear are stopped and removed on the next scan.
- A new watcher seeks to end-of-file. Positions live in memory only, so a
restart resumes from the current end of each file and content written while
LogWisp was down is not read.
from = "start"reads each file whole when its watcher is created instead — what a process writing beside LogWisp needs, at the cost of replaying a file already on disk at every restart. - Rotation is detected from size decrease, modification-time reset, a position beyond end-of-file, or an inode change. An inode change where the new file is already larger than the recorded position is treated as an atomic save, not a rotation, and the position is preserved.
- A rotation that renames in place — what a size-capped writer does — puts the
same inode back under a name
patternalso matches. Its watcher resumes at the position the original reached, sofrom = "start"reads the tail an unfinished read left behind rather than the whole archive a second time. - A line is parsed as JSON only when it is an object whose top-level keys are
all drawn from
time,level,msgandfields— the four an entry can carry.timeis read as RFC3339Nano. Any other key, and any non-object line, is kept whole as text with the level inferred from common markers ([ERROR],WARN:, and so on), because parsing it would drop the rest. raw = trueskips the JSON branch entirely. The line, plus its newline, becomes the message;fieldsstays empty, the time is the read time, and the level is inferred from the text as for any unparsed line. Paired withformat.type = "raw"this is byte-exact transport for records LogWisp's envelope cannot hold — see Formatters.Sourceis set to the file's base name.
Statistics: per-watcher size, position, entries read, rotation count, and
last read time, plus active_watchers.
console
Reads newline-delimited entries from standard input.
[[pipelines.plugin_sources]]
id = "stdin"
type = "console"
[pipelines.plugin_sources.config]
buffer_size = 1000
| Option | Type | Default | Description |
|---|---|---|---|
buffer_size |
int | 1000 |
Subscriber channel depth |
At most one instance per pipeline: the type is registered with
MaxInstances: 1, and a second instance is rejected at pipeline construction.
The level is inferred from the line text, and Source is set to console.
random
Synthetic entry generator for development, smoke tests, and sanitizer testing.
[[pipelines.plugin_sources]]
id = "generator"
type = "random"
[pipelines.plugin_sources.config]
interval_ms = 500
jitter_ms = 0
format = "txt"
length = 20
special = false
| Option | Type | Default | Description |
|---|---|---|---|
interval_ms |
int | 500 |
Emission period |
jitter_ms |
int | 0 |
Symmetric jitter; clamped to interval_ms, must be non-negative |
format |
string | txt |
raw (message only), txt (bracketed line), json (JSON object as the message) |
length |
int | 20 |
Message length in characters |
special |
bool | false |
Inject control and non-ASCII characters |
special = true is the intended way to exercise sanitizer policies: it inserts
control bytes and multi-byte Unicode into otherwise ordinary messages. Levels
are chosen at random from DEBUG, INFO, WARN, ERROR.
null
Produces nothing. Useful as a placeholder so a sink-only pipeline satisfies the "at least one source" requirement.
[[pipelines.plugin_sources]]
id = "void"
type = "null"
No options.
tcp_chain
Listens for persistent NDJSON streams from upstream LogWisp tcp_chain sinks.
See Chaining for the protocol.
[[pipelines.plugin_sources]]
id = "ingest_tcp"
type = "tcp_chain"
[pipelines.plugin_sources.config]
host = "0.0.0.0"
port = 15801
buffer_size = 1000
max_connections = 0
read_timeout_ms = 0
hello_timeout_ms = 10000
trust_node = true
[pipelines.plugin_sources.config.tls]
enabled = true
cert_file = "/etc/logwisp/tls/server.crt"
key_file = "/etc/logwisp/tls/server.key"
client_auth = true
client_ca_file = "/etc/logwisp/tls/client-ca.crt"
min_version = "1.3"
[pipelines.plugin_sources.config.auth]
type = "mtls"
allow = ["edge-01", "edge-02"]
node_binding = "force"
| Option | Type | Default | Description |
|---|---|---|---|
host |
string | 0.0.0.0 |
Bind address; IPv4 only |
port |
int | required | Listen port, 1–65535 |
buffer_size |
int | 1000 |
Subscriber channel depth |
max_connections |
int | 0 |
Concurrent connection cap; 0 = unlimited |
read_timeout_ms |
int | 0 |
Per-connection idle read deadline; 0 = none |
hello_timeout_ms |
int | 10000 |
Deadline for the hello preamble |
trust_node |
bool | true |
false overrides the sender's node label with its remote address. Ignored when auth.node_binding is active |
tls |
table | — | Listener TLS; see Security |
auth |
table | — | Peer authorization and node binding; see Security |
Behaviour
- TLS handshakes run explicitly with a 10 s bound before the preamble is read,
after the
max_connectionsadmission check. - Authorization runs between the handshake and the hello read, so an
unauthorized peer never gets a preamble parsed on its behalf. A rejection is
logged at WARN and counted in
rejected_conns. - A connection is rejected if the first line is not a valid hello with a matching protocol version.
- The node label is then resolved: under
auth.node_bindingit comes from the peer's certificate, otherwisetrust_nodegoverns.forcealso overrides thenodefield on every individual entry;assertleaves per-entry labels totrust_node, so a relay can forward other nodes' entries while proving its own identity. - Each accepted connection gets a session recording the remote address, node
label, — under TLS —
tlsandtls_peer_cn, and — under auth —auth_methodandauth_identity. - A malformed entry line increments
parse_errorsand is skipped; the connection survives. A line over 1 MiB is a protocol violation and terminates the connection.
Statistics: active_connections, rejected_conns, parse_errors,
tls_handshake_errors, trust_node, auth, auth_allowed, auth_rejected,
node_binding.
http_chain
Accepts NDJSON batches POSTed by upstream LogWisp http_chain sinks.
[[pipelines.plugin_sources]]
id = "ingest_http"
type = "http_chain"
[pipelines.plugin_sources.config]
host = "0.0.0.0"
port = 15802
ingest_path = "/ingest"
buffer_size = 1000
max_body_bytes = 8388608
read_timeout_ms = 30000
trust_node = true
[pipelines.plugin_sources.config.tls]
enabled = true
cert_file = "/etc/logwisp/tls/server.crt"
key_file = "/etc/logwisp/tls/server.key"
client_auth = true
client_ca_file = "/etc/logwisp/tls/client-ca.crt"
[pipelines.plugin_sources.config.auth]
type = "mtls"
allow = ["edge-01", "edge-02"]
node_binding = "force"
| Option | Type | Default | Description |
|---|---|---|---|
host |
string | 0.0.0.0 |
Bind address; IPv4 only |
port |
int | required | Listen port |
ingest_path |
string | /ingest |
Endpoint path; must start with / |
buffer_size |
int | 1000 |
Subscriber channel depth |
max_body_bytes |
int | 8388608 |
Per-request body cap (8 MiB) |
read_timeout_ms |
int | 30000 |
Full request read deadline |
trust_node |
bool | true |
false overrides the sender's node label with its remote address. Ignored when auth.node_binding is active |
tls |
table | — | Listener TLS |
auth |
table | — | Peer authorization and node binding; see Security |
Behaviour
- Only
POSTtoingest_pathis routed; other methods get405with anAllowheader, and other paths get404. - Authorization runs before the body is read, so an unauthorized sender does not
get to stream
max_body_bytesinto the process. Both a policy rejection and a node-binding failure answer403, distinct from the400used for protocol errors, so a sender can tell "not allowed" from "malformed batch". - A missing or mismatched
X-Logwisp-Protocolheader is rejected with400. - Batch acceptance is atomic: entries are published only after the body reads
cleanly end to end. A transfer error rejects the whole batch (
400, or413when the body cap is hit) so the sender retries it. A malformed line inside an otherwise clean transfer is skipped and counted inparse_errors. - Success is
204 No ContentwithX-Logwisp-Acceptedset to the number of entries ingested. - Sessions are cached per remote host + node + authenticated identity, and recreated after idle expiry. Including the identity in the key means two peers sharing a remote address never share a session.
Statistics: total_requests, rejected_requests, parse_errors,
cached_sessions, trust_node, auth, auth_allowed, auth_rejected,
node_binding.
Source Statistics
Every source reports: id, type, total_entries, dropped_entries,
start_time, last_entry_time, and a type-specific details map. These appear
in the status reporter output and in the http sink's status endpoint.
